The Neighborhood:
This is a quiet neighborhood and a lake that has no public access. We have many guests who enjoy the peacefulness our lake provides. Others get their big-water fix by trailering their boats a short distance to the nearby world-class lakes which surround us, including Round Lake, Lac Courte Oreilles (of world record Musky fame), the Chippewa Flowage, Sand lake and Grindstone which provide access to boat launch.
Getting Around: We're a short drive from the village of Hayward, and its many shops, restaurants, bars and essentials-markets, including a large grocery store (Market Place) and a Walmart. (GPS can lead you too Whispering Pines Court, make sure you are googling Whispering Pines Trail.) There are some fun activities to do around the Hayward area, Mini Golf, Horseback riding a movie theater in town and a petting zoo. ATV and snowmobile trails are easily accessed from our property, and can take you all over northwest . In the winter months you can take Highway 27 to Christie Mountain to go skiing or snow boarding about an hour away as well.
If you want to travel a bit further up north take Highway 77 towards Superior. Our favorite go to , Amnicon Falls Park for a nice picnic and hiking to see the five waterfalls Right before that is or Big Manitou Falls in Patterson Park. Duluth or Bayfield is about 1.5 hours drive from there for a more adventurous outing.
